**What does your day at GIP look like?**.
The Quality Control Field Technician will be responsible for supporting all aspects of quality control under the supervision of project managers, supervisors or scheduling coordinators.
- Inspect the quality of construction and construction materials (aggregates and asphalt).
- Monitor material placement and workmanship.
- Review documents and specifications.
- Maintain daily check list diary and site activities.
- Report any non-conformance concerns while on site to management.
- Execute tests in the field or laboratory on construction materials to assess their quality.
- Prepare and collect Aggregates and asphalt samples for laboratory testing.
- Perform compaction testing by Nuclear Densometer.
- Asphalt coring
- Ensure accuracy of test data.
- Perform visual inspections of roadways
- Maintain equipment
- Maintain calibration of equipment
